Wheat is getting more expensive regardless of quality

Over the past week, the price of food and feed wheat in Ukraine rose by 2% and 4% respectively, to an average of 219$/t and 215$/t in the south and center of the country, Logos Press reported.

Wheat is getting more expensive regardless of quality

The Ukrainian media explain the price increase and the abnormally small price difference between milling and feed wheat by a combination of reasons. First, it is the generally high quality of wheat of the 2025 harvest. Secondly, the late start of the harvesting campaign in some Black Sea countries, including some regions of Ukraine and many regions of Russia. Thirdly, situationally high demand from traders for grain to cover “burning contracts”. Fourthly, the desire of many farmers to hold back quality products of the new harvest in the hope of further price growth, resulting in a relatively low supply of marketable wheat on the grain market.

The situation in the Republic of Moldova follows a similar scenario. Over the last two weeks, the price of wheat of the new harvest has increased by about 0.20-0.30 lei/kg. “In the north of the country, wheat is currently purchased at 2.75- 3.00 lei/kg, while in the Giurgiulesti port area the prices have increased to 3.40-3.50 lei/kg,” states Iurie Rija, an expert in agro-marketing. – For comparison, two weeks ago in the same area in the south of the country the offer was more modest, prices fluctuated within 3.10-3.20 lei/kg”.

The significant increase in wheat prices was due to the fact that two large-tonnage barges are currently loading wheat in Giurgiulesti, which boosted the demand of traders. In order to replenish the stocks needed to fulfill already concluded contracts, buying traders are offering higher prices, stimulating competition and activating the local market in the short term.

At the same time, the price for feed grain is lower than for food grain only by 0.10-0.15 lei/kg. According to Boris Boinchan, an expert of the National Center of Science, Technology and Seed Production, such market arrangement is not fair for those farmers who observe crop rotations and invest more in agro-technologies that ensure not only the quantity but also the quality of wheat harvest. But at the moment, by a specific coincidence of circumstances, such is the regional grain market.
